Unlike most traditional puzzle games, you don't really have to figure out what to do, but rather how to do it. Unlike the real Lego models, you have no manuals to assist you, and after some easy challenges to get you started the difficulty quickly ramps up. You don't need to be a civil engineer to get through the game, but on the other hand, you can't turn off your brain completely. The Austrian developer ClockStone Studios has managed to create some pretty complex building mechanics - perhaps not unsurprisingly coming from the team behind the Bridge Constructor series.
